I emailed the port maintainer about this... and didn't get a reply, so I figure I'll ask here. I've noticed these errors in the slimserver.log: mDNSResponderPosix: Unexpected argument '/var/db/slimserver/cache/mDNS.conf' Usage: mDNSResponderPosix [-v level ] [-r] [-n name] [-t type] [-d domain] [-p port] [-f file] [-b] [-P pidfile] [-x name=val ...] -v verbose mode, level is a number from 0 to 2 0 = no debugging info (default) 1 = standard debugging info 2 = intense debugging info can be cycled kill -USR1 -r also bind to port 53 (port 5353 is always bound) -n uses 'name' as the service name (required) -t uses 'type' as the service type (default is '_afpovertcp._tcp.') -d uses 'domain' as the service domain (default is 'local.') -p uses 'port' as the port number (default is '548') -f reads a service list from 'file' -b forces daemon (background) mode -P uses 'pidfile' as the PID file (default is '/var/run/mDNSResponder.pid') only meaningful if -b also specified -x stores name=val in TXT record (default is empty). MUST be the last command-line argument; all subsequent arguments after -x are treated as name=val pairs. mDNSResponderPosix: Unexpected argument '/var/db/slimserver/cache/mDNS.conf' 2005-12-22 02:46:12.7084 ERROR: Couldn't open song. 2005-12-22 02:46:17.8440 ERROR: Couldn't gotoNext, stopping I don't know what mdns.conf is really supposed to have in it; however, I'm not able to play anything on my slimserver now, and I wonder if it's related to this problem.
